The Reform Party, and then the Canadian Alliance, existed ONLY because of some conservatives deep dislike and distrust of Brian Mulroney..............they destroyed his government, and the Progressive Conservative Party of Canada because the HATED Mulroney.

I should know, I'm one of them.

It is a bit of a stretch to blame the people that pulled Mulroney down for his actions.
